Alice Cooper Has A New Live Album Coming

by Noise11.com on July 13, 2018

in News

Alice Cooper will release a live album recorded in Paris as apart of his Paranormal tour of 2017.

‘A Paranormal Evening At The Olympia Paris’ was recorded in the French capital on December 7, 2017.

The Olympia opened 130 years ago in 1888. Edith Piaf, The Beatles and now Alice Cooper have played there.

The band is Alice’s longtime musicians, guitarists Nita Strauss, Tommy Henriksen and Ryan Roxie, bassist Chuck Garric and drummer Glen Sobel

“A Paranormal Evening At The Olympia Paris” will be released on August 31st, 2018 on earMUSIC as 2CD digipak, 2LP Gatefold (white and red LP) and Digital.
